PAGCOR spreads joy to senior citizens in Pampanga and Mandaluyong

Monday | Dec. 19, 2016 | 5:00 PM

The Philippine Amusement and Gaming Corporation (PAGCOR) hosted festive Christmas celebrations for over 1,600 elderly in Pampanga and Mandaluyong during the ninth and tenth days of the agency’s 2016 Pamaskong Handog project.

Some 1,000 members of the United Pampanga Senior Citizens Organization (UPSCO) and over 600 members of Mandaluyong Federation of Senior Citizens were treated to fun-filled Christmas parties on December 16 and 17, respectively. Aside from the festive celebration, they received gift packs containing noche buena staples like ham, spaghetti noodles, fruit cocktail, cheese, among others.

UPSCO President Linda David – whose group gathered the senior citizen chapters from the various municipalities of Pampanga to take part in PAGCOR’s Pamaskong Handog – shared that it’s not every day that an organization approaches them to bring happiness to their members. David is blessed because her children are all successful in their chosen fields. But she continues to actively advocate for the rights of less privileged elderly through the UPSCO because majority of the senior citizens in Pampanga are not as fortunate as her. “Marami sa aming mga miyembro ay hindi naman mayayaman. Kaya ang organisasyon ay gumagawa ng paraan para yung mga well-off na senior citizens dito matulungan yung walang-wala, especially sa mga gamot.”

David added that the one percent annual internal revenue allocation of the local government for the elderly sector is likewise not enough to sustain the needs of their indigent members. “Hindi lahat ng one percent allocation ng local government ay napupunta sa senior citizens. Kahati namin diyan ang mga persons with disability. Kaya masaya kami dahil may mga tao at organisasyon kagaya ng PAGCOR na handang tumulong. Masayang-masaya din kami dahil pinaghandaan ng PAGCOR ang Pamasko para sa amin ngayong taon. To PAGCOR Chairman Didi Domingo, our former Congresswoman whom we respect and admire, thank you for giving us a Christmas celebration that we will all remember,” she said.
